PC*Miler is a routing and mileage tool used to calculate routes and distances between locations. It can support route optimization for planning and helps teams apply consistent mileage logic for brokerage quoting, rating, and billing.
The TruckMaster + PC*Miler integration sends route parameters from TruckMaster to PC*Miler and returns mileage and routing results back into your TMS.

TruckMaster sends route inputs such as origin, destination, and optional stops. PC*Miler returns routing outputs and calculated mileage results that can be used in TruckMaster workflows.
Routing and mileage results can be surfaced in TruckMaster where trips, loads, or billing/rating workflows reference distance and planning details, depending on your configuration.
